Latest Patents

Nyquist holds a patent titled "Linear genome assembly from three-dimensional genome structure." This patent outlines a method for sequencing and assembling long DNA genomes by generating a 3D contact map of chromatin loop structures. The method defines spatial proximity relationships between genomic loci in the genome and derives a linear genomic nucleic acid sequence from the 3D map of chromatin loop structures. This innovation is crucial for advancing genomic research and applications.
